Radiall Powers the Future of Space at the 40th Space Symposium
Radiall recently participated in the 40th Space Symposium held from April 7-10, 2025, at the Broadmoor in Colorado Springs, Colorado. This premier event brought together thousands of space industry professionals to explore the latest advancements and foster collaboration. Radiall highlighted its innovative line of space-qualified components, including RF coaxial connectors, optical cable assemblies and high repeatability and space-qualified switches, emphasizing their commitment to supporting the evolving needs of the space sector. We displayed some of the following:
Coaxial Connectors
Radiall’s space-qualified coaxial connectors are engineered to operate up to Q band frequencies. These connectors are made to withstand the harsh conditions of space, offering reliable performance for satellite and spacecraft systems.
Coaxial Switches
Radiall’s coaxial switches are built to endure over 100,000 actuations and have a lifespan of up to 15 years. Operating up to Ka band, these switches are integral for RF signal routing in spaceborne communication systems.
RF Cable Assemblies
Radiall offers a comprehensive range of space rated RF cable assemblies, including flexible low loss and semi-rigid options, all optimized for high-frequency performance and low loss. These assemblies are tailored to meet the stringent demands of space missions, ensuring signal integrity and durability.
Optical Cable Assemblies
Designed for satellite payload equipment, Radiall’s space-grade optical cable assemblies feature radiation-tolerant components and qualified optical connectors. These assemblies provide robust, lightweight and compact solutions for high-speed data transmission in space environments.
